Assalamualaikum wr. wb.


A. PENDAHULUAN

PENGERTIAN

  • Hypertext Transfer Protocol (HTTP) adalah protokol yang mengatur komunikasi antara client dan server. Yang menjadi client adalah web browser atau device lain yang dapat mengakses, menerima dan menampilkan konten web. HTTP disebut protokol Stateless karena setiap perintah dijalankan secara independen, tanpa pengetahuan tentang perintah yang datang sebelumnya. Ini adalah alasan utama yang sulit untuk menerapkan situs Website yang bereaksi secara cerdas untuk input pengguna.
  • Hypertext Transfer Protocol Secure (HTTPS) adalah versi secure dari HTTP yang dikembangkan oleh Netscape Communications Corp. Https dapat menjamin keamanan dalam Autentikasi server yaitumemungkinkan peramban dan pengguna memiliki kepercayaan bahwa mereka sedang berbicara kepada server aplikasi sesungguhnya.Https juga mampu dalam menjaga kerahasiaan data dan Integritas data. 

B. LATAR BELAKANG 

Mengetahui dan memahami Http dan Https dengan pengertian fungsi dan perbedaanya, karena ini cukup lumayan penting khususnya jika teman-teman yang berkecimpung di dunia IT. 

C. MAKSUD DAN TUJUAN
  • Dapat mengetahui fungsi dari HTTP dan HTTPS.
  • Dapat mengetahui perbedaan dari HTTP  dan HTTPS
D. PEMBAHASAN 

    PENGERTIAN HTTP DAN HTTPS



Hypertext Transfer Protocol (HTTP) adalah protokol yang mengatur komunikasi antara client dan server. Yang menjadi client adalah web browser atau device lain yang dapat mengakses, menerima dan menampilkan konten web.

Pada umumnya cara komunikasi antara client dan server adalah client melakukan request ke server, kemudian server mengirimkan respon terhadap client. Respon yang dimaksud dapat berupa file HTML yang akan ditampilkan di browser ataupun data lain yang di-request oleh client. Semua kegiatan tersebut diatur oleh suatu protokol yang sedang kita bahas, yaitu HTTP.


Sedangkan Hypertext Transfer Protocol Secure (HTTPS) adalah versi secure dari HTTP yang dikembangkan oleh Netscape Communications Corp. https berfungsi agar blog kita itu terenkripsi oleh system agar data yang selalu keluar dan masuk dari web tersebut tu AMAN,,, agar kita bisa menggunakan HTTPS kita harus membeli/menginstal SSL yang berfungsi memberikan sertifikat aman kepada website kita namun jika kalian menggunakan Protokol HTTP kalian tidak akan bisa akses Protokol HTTPS karena web kalian tidak memiliki sertifikat SSL yang sah, tetapi jika web tersebut menggunakan Protokol HTTPS web tersebut masih bisa juga menggunakan Protokol HTTP karena http bisa di sebut protokol yang tidak terenkripsi jadi semua akses web tersebut bisa di sebut tidak aman sedangkan yang https bisa di sebut aman.

PERBEDAAN ANTARA HTTP DAN HTTPS


Keamanan data yang dikirimkan 
HTTP tidak menjamin keamanan data yang ditransmisikan antara client dengan server. Sementara HTTPS menjamin keamanan data yang dikirimkan. Berbicara keamanan data, sedikitnya ada 3 aspek yang ditangani oleh HTTPS, yaitu:

  • Autentikasi Server, dengan adanya autentikasi server, pengguna yakin sepenuhnya bahwa ia sedang berkomunikasi dengan server yang ia tuju. 
  • Kerahasiaan Data, data yang ditransmisikan tidak akan bisa dipahami oleh pihak lain, karena data yang ditransmisikan sudah dienkripsi. 
  • Integritas Data, data yang sedang ditransmisikan tidak dapat diubah oleh pihak lain, karena akan divalidasi oleh message authentication code (MAC).

Port yang digunakan 
Untuk melakukan komunikasi, secara default HTTP menggunakan port 80 sedangkan HTTPS menggunakan port 443.

Kebutuhan SSL 
Secara default, protokol yang digunakan untuk komunikasi client-server adalah HTTP. Sementara untuk dapat menggunakan protokol HTTPS, kita diharuskan memiliki sertifikat SSL. Secure Socket Layers (SSL) adalah teknologi keamanan yang memungkinkan untuk melakukan enkripsi terhadap data yang akan ditransmisikan antara client dan server. SSL memungkinkan kita untuk dapat mengirim informasi penting, seperti nomor kartu kredit dan login credential, dengan aman.

H. KESIMPULAN
 
Jadi intinya perbedaan HTTP dan HTTPS adalah jika HTTPS itu di beri lapisan Enkripsi agar web tersebut aman

I. REFERENSI

Demikianlah yang bisa saya sampaikan mudah mudahna bisa bermanfaat khususnya untuk teman teman semua, sehingga kita semua dapat mengetahui dan memahami baik itu perbedaan dari pengertian baik dari kinerja dan fungsinnya. 


Wassalamualaikum Warohmatullahi Wabarokaatuh.